Description
150 and 250mm versions, particularly suitable for industrial use including, high pressure, high vacuum and high vibration applications. Tip Junction insulated from the sheath. Stainless steel (310). Temp range: probe 0 to + 1100°C, plug 220°C (max). Bendable for fitting in difficult access locations Bendable probes with a Stainless Steel 310 or Inconel 600 sheath. Inconel has excellent oxidation resistant properties. For version with standard plug see RS 787-7793. Temperature range: Probe 0 to +1100°C. Pot seal 0 to +180°C. 100mm of 7//0.2mm PTFE insulated cable Thermocouple Type = K Probe Length = 1m Probe Diameter = 1mm Probe Material = Stainless Steel Minimum Temperature Sensed = -100°C Maximum Temperature Sensed = +1100°C Cable Length = 100mm Termination Type = Miniature Plug Standards Met = IEC
